Brian has joined the pilot for The CW's Beauty and the Beast as -- wait for it -- a homicide detective! :woohoo:
There’s a new player in the NYPD Homicide Unit on CW’s ‘Beauty and the Beast’ and it’s none other than Brian White.

White can be seen in the upcoming Joss Whedon’s horror ‘Cabin in the Woods’ which will be in wide release in April. He also played Lt. Carl Davis in the vampire series ‘Moonlight’ as well as starred in the series ‘The Shield’ and ‘Men of a Certain Age’ with Ray Romano and Andre Braugher.
